    350x frame question

    i bought a 350x a few months back tore it down and been waiting for after the holidays to start sinking some $ into it. anyways i was looking at the crack that is on the left side (the normal spot for the 85's) and there is a chunk of metal missing and at first it looked like someone tried to weld it with a stick welder and burned right thru. well after looking over tank350s build thread i relized there is a tab there that must have gotten ripped of the frame!

    my question is what is the tab for? i was going to gusset the frame and do a wrap for the crack but now i'm wondering if i should look for a new frame.

    I'd build my own tab with .125 steel, piece of cake...

    Never let an ARC welder near any Honda products. IDT one piece on that machine has anything thicker than 3 or 4mm's or about .125/.1875.

    Be forewarned, that tab is CRITICAL and has to be dead nuts! and the welds have to be fantastic...................
